When they proved to be too costly, he decided to hire Jule Styne and Leo Robin to write a different score. Its success on Broadway prompted Harry Cohn, head of Columbia Pictures, which had released the 1942 screen adaptation of the play, to seek the film rights to the musical. My Sister Eileen was an adaptation of a play that premiered in December 1940, which in turn was inspired by short stories written by Ruth McKenney in the 1930s. Fields and Jerome Chodorov adapted their 1940 play for Wonderful Town, with lyrics by Betty Comden and Adolph Green and music by Leonard Bernstein.
